And when the days of their purification according to the law of Moses were completed, they brought him to Jerusalem to present him to the Lord, as it is written in the law of the Lord: "Every firstborn male shall be called holy to the Lord," read more.
and to offer a sacrifice, according to what is directed in the law of the Lord: "A pair of turtle doves, or two young pigeons." And lo! there was a man in Jerusalem, whose name was Simeon; and he was a righteous and devout man, waiting for the consolation of Israel. And the Holy Spirit was upon him; and it had been revealed to him by the Holy Spirit, that he should not see death before he had seen the Christ of the Lord. And he came in the Spirit into the temple; and when the parents brought in the child Jesus, to do for him according to the custom of the law, he took him in his arms, and blessed God, and said, Lord! now lettest thou thy servant depart in peace, according to thy word; for mine eyes have seen thy salvation, which thou hast prepared before the face of all the peoples; a light to enlighten the gentiles, and to be the glory of thy people Israel. And his father and his mother marveled at what was spoken concerning him. And Simeon blessed them, and said to Mary his mother, Behold, this child is appointed for the fall and rising of many in Israel, and for a sign that will be spoken against; yea, a sword will pierce through thine own soul,that the thoughts of many hearts may be revealed. And there was Anna, a prophetess, daughter of Phanuel: of the tribe of Asher; she was of great age, and had lived with a husband seven years from her virginity; and she was a widow eightyfour years old, who never left the temple, worshipping with fastings and prayers night and day. And she came up at this very time, and gave thanks to God, and spoke of him to all that were looking for the redemption of Jerusalem.
